UCL Surgical Society x Royal Society of Medicine (RSM) presents this surgical skills day to provide medical students with the opportunity to learn and practise essential surgical skills in a structured, hands-on environment.
Session Details:
Learn about the following:
- Principles of wound healing
- Different indications for suture & suture materials
- Setting up a sterile field & safe handling of surgical equipment
- Administration of local anaesthetic
Gain practical experience in the following techniques:
- Simple interrupted suturing (basic suturing)
- Simple continuous suturing
- Instrument tie & surgeon's knot
- Hand tying techniques
- Mattress suturing (horizontal and vertical)
- Subcuticular suturing
- Review of all techniques learnt
Each session is delivered by doctors, surgical trainees and offers:
- Hands-on practice in core surgical skills
- Guidance and immediate feedback from experts
- Progressive skill-building
- A certificate upon completion
